Registered Nurse
Posted 10 days ago
Job Viewed
Job Description
**Reports to (position):** Dialysis Clinic Manager
**Primary purpose of the role** :
Responsible to deliver patient centred care within the hemodialysis setting in accordance with organisational core values / standards of practice and codes and guidelines as set out by APHRA. To provide support to the Management Team by participating in the clinical, management, education and quality activities of staff and patients within the clinic.
**Key Responsibilities:**
+ Participates in the design, planning, delivery and evaluation of patient care within the hemodialysis clinical setting.
+ Protects the rights of patients by adhering to Privacy Principles and providing an excellent standard of care.
+ Responsible for own professional development and provides education to colleagues, patients and visitors.
+ Ensures/promotes a safe, secure and healthy working environment to staff and a comfortable, safe environment for visitors and patients as detailed in the Workplace Health and Safety policy (FMEAU-28).
+ Actively participates in the quality improvement process by reporting all incidents, hazards and opportunities for improvement.
+ Completes clinical and mandatory competencies annually
+ Performs defined management functions when required.
+ Maintains accurate patient information in medical records, including Therapy Data Management System (TDMS) and abides by confidentiality and Privacy Policy. Competencies (attitude, skills, typical qualifications & experience)
**Essential:**
+ Registered as a general nurse with AHPRA (Australian Health Practitioner Regulation Agency).
+ Current practicing certificate.
+ Understanding of the Quality improvement process and risk management obligations
+ Demonstrated clinical competence and expertise (or working towards) in nephrology nursing.
+ Ability to continuously reflect on nursing practice and apply learning as appropriate.
+ Effective communication and interpersonal skills including the ability to operate within multidisciplinary team.
+ Demonstrated organisational, decision-making and problem solving skills, combined with the ability to be self-directed.
+ Demonstrated ability to effectively perform staff and patient education.
+ Knowledge of nursing, nephrology and other professional issues which impact on nursing practice within the specialty.
**Desirable:**
+ Nephrology nursing theory and practice.
+ Computer literacy.
Demonstrated commitment to quality improvement initiatives.
Aircraft Maintenance Engineer - Mechanical

Posted 16 days ago
Job Viewed
Job Description
RELOCATION ASSISTANCE: Relocation assistance may be available
CLEARANCE TYPE: AU-Top Secret (NV2)
TRAVEL: Yes, 10% of the Time
**Description**
**Be Part of Something Big - Keep Triton Flying**
Join Northrop Grumman Australia at **RAAF Base Tindal, NT** , and help bring the next generation of unmanned aircraft into service. We're building something unique - a growing team with world-leading tech, a generous salary, and full relocation support to Katherine for you and your family.
We're proud of our supportive, fun and down-to earth culture where everyone contributes, everyone matters, and you'll be part of the team from day one.
**Your Role**
You'll be part of the team responsible for getting MQ-4C Triton Unmanned Aircraft Systems mission-ready - every time. Working alongside experienced technicians and engineers, you'll:
+ Carry out scheduled and unscheduled maintenance on Triton UAS to ensure safety, reliability, and airworthiness.
+ Work closely with a new, supportive team to deliver multiple serviceable aircraft on time and to standard.
+ Identify tooling, manpower, and facility needs, and provide solutions for technical and logistics challenges.
+ Report and follow up on major defects and ensure documentation accuracy.
**About You**
You're a hands-on AME (Mechanical) who thrives on solving problems and working with cutting-edge technology. You're ready for the next big step in your career and are open to a move to Katherine, NT.
+ Cert IV in Aeroskills (Mechanical) is essential.
+ Experience in aviation maintenance with a passion for delivering safe, serviceable aircraft.
+ Strong problem-solving skills and a proactive approach to technical challenges.
+ Team player who enjoys working collaboratively in a high-performing environment.
+ Excited by the chance to work on advanced UAS technology with global impact.

Continuous Quality Improvement (CQI) Coordinator | Northern Territory
Posted 1 day ago
Job Viewed
Job Description
We are seeking an experienced Continuous Quality Improvement (CQI) Coordinator to drive the integration, implementation, and ongoing enhancement of quality systems across the organisation.
In this pivotal role, you will lead initiatives to ensure compliance with key accreditation standards (RACGP, ISO, and NDIS) while embedding a culture of continuous improvement. Your leadership will support the delivery of safe, effective, and culturally responsive healthcare services, strengthening outcomes for the community.
Job details
- 6 weeks annual leave + 18% leave loading
- Relocation assistance provided + Relocation Grant can be applied for
- Salary packaging up to $15,899 p.a.
- Company vehicle for work-related travel
- Laptop and mobile phone provided
- Up to 10 days study leave per year
- Supportive and collaborative team environment
- Lead the design, implementation, and monitoring of quality systems, audits, and compliance frameworks.
- Coordinate internal audits and support accreditation and re-accreditation processes.
- Identify opportunities to improve clinical quality, safety, and operational efficiency.
- Develop CQI strategies, dashboards, and reports in partnership with leadership.
- Monitor improvement initiatives and ensure timely completion of action plans.
- Provide training and education to staff on quality standards and procedures.
- Align all CQI initiatives with the organisations strategic goals and community needs.
- You are a passionate health professional with a strong commitment to quality improvement and clinical governance.
- Current AHPRA registration with the Nursing and Midwifery Board of Australia (or eligibility).
- Postgraduate qualification in a relevant clinical specialty (desirable).
- Demonstrated experience in quality systems, audits, and accreditation.
- Strong problem-solving and data analysis skills.
- Excellent communication and engagement skills across all levels.
- A sound understanding of the cultural, social, and economic factors influencing Aboriginal health.
